The expiration date on Gedney pickles is typically found printed on the jar lid or on the label itself, often towards the bottom. It's usually in the format of a month and year. If you're unable to find it, check for a "best by" date, which indicates the best quality period for the product. Always inspect the pickles for any signs of spoilage, regardless of the date.
